Demographic Characteristics
Measurable features of an audience that can be counted objectively: age, education level, income, etc.
Psychographic Characteristics
Attributes relating to the personality, values, attitudes, interests, or lifestyles of individuals or groups, used especially for market segmentation.
Audience Members
Individuals who actively listen, watch, or engage with a presentation, performance, or broadcast.
Intrinsic Motivators
Internal factors, such as personal interest or satisfaction, that drive individuals to perform tasks.
